The LG LFCS22596S French door refrigerator has a spacious interior with advanced features that are ideal for busy families. Its InstaView Door-in-Door feature lets you to view the inside of your refrigerator without opening the door. By double-knocking the tinted door, it transparent and opens up a compartment that keeps cold air inside while still giving easy access to the most frequently used items. The interior of the refrigerator has four adjustable shelves as well as two crisper drawers that are controlled by humidity and an Glide N Serve drawer that can be used for large platters and deli tray.
Cool Guard metal panels, which regulate temperatures and Door Cooling+ are other cool features of the LG refrigerator. The adjustable temperature drawer has five settings including freeze, meat and fish, deli, snacks and drinks, as well as wine.

This model has a dual-ice maker which produces both cubed and crushed ice. Its Craft Ice feature produces slow-melting ice spheres that are ideal for cocktails and other drinks. The convenient double-door swings make it easy to find and organize items.
This refrigerator is sleek and black, with an stainless steel handle. It is spacious inside and is ENERGY Energy Star-certified. Warranty
A warranty can protect you from expensive repair costs. There are a variety of options for warranty on appliances, based on your requirements and the manufacturer. The most comprehensive are provided by the manufacturer themselves as well as those offered by third parties. In either case, a good knowledge of what's covered is essential to maximize your investment.
The standard limited warranty on your refrigerator covers the manufacturing and material defects for a period of one year after the date of purchase. However, this warranty does not cover damage caused by improper repairs or misuse, or cosmetic damages such as scratches and dents. The warranty may also be voided in the event that you are not the original owner.
If you encounter an issue, contact LG for repair assistance through their customer service department, or online. LG will send a technician to your residence and replace or repair the part that is defective. The warranty does not cover installation fees or travel expenses, so you'll have to pay for those services. In-home warranty services are available within a 150km radius from the nearest LG authorized service center (ASC). If you live outside the 150km radius you must bring your appliance to the ASC to be repaired.
